The Mechanism · Gated-generation receipt

gen-briefly-explain-the-kullback-leibler-divergence-and-one-comm-3922

stable pending witness
2026-05-29 02:26:46 UTC · anthropic/claude-sonnet-4-5

Prompt

Briefly explain the Kullback-Leibler divergence and one common misconception about it.
86 chars

Generation

# Kullback-Leibler Divergence **KL divergence** measures how much one probability distribution differs from another reference distribution. For discrete distributions P and Q, it's defined as: $$D_{KL}(P \| Q) = \sum_i P(i) \log \frac{P(i)}{Q(i)}$$ It quantifies the "extra bits" needed to encode data from distribution P when using a code optimized for distribution Q, or equivalently, the information lost when Q is used to approximate P. ## Common Misconception **It's NOT a distance metric.** While often called "KL distance," it violates key metric properties: - **Not symmetric**: $D_{KL}(P \| Q) \neq D_{KL}(Q \| P)$ in general - **No triangle inequality**: Doesn't satisfy $D_{KL}(P \| R) \leq D_{KL}(P \| Q) + D_{KL}(Q \| R)$ This asymmetry matters in practice—using KL divergence in machine learning or optimization can give different results depending on which distribution you choose as the reference.
28 tokens in · 273 tokens out · 6060 ms · $0.0042

The four gates

RED
pass
no disqualifying input patterns detected
FLOOR
pass
output above protective minimum; no mismatches
WAY
pass
no declared way_path (Way check NA); no coercion language
EXECUTION
deferred
no witnesses available (Witness Roll not yet constituted)

Verifier results

scripture_anchors NOT_APPLICABLE
0 Scripture citation(s) extracted
theology_doctrine NOT_APPLICABLE
no doctrine keyword patterns detected

Metrics

Total latency
6065.9 ms
Base LLM
6059.9 ms
Verifiers
0.3 ms
Gates
0.0 ms
Cost
$0.0042

Trail

02:26:46 received prompt_chars=86 verifiers=['scripture_anchors', 'theology_doctrine']
02:26:46 red_gate decision=pass reason=no disqualifying input patterns detected
02:26:52 base_llm_call model=anthropic/claude-sonnet-4-5 tokens_in=28 tokens_out=273 latency_ms=6059.9 cost_usd=0.0042
02:26:52 verifier:scripture_anchors verdict=NOT_APPLICABLE summary=0 Scripture citation(s) extracted
02:26:52 verifier:theology_doctrine verdict=NOT_APPLICABLE summary=no doctrine keyword patterns detected
02:26:52 floor_gate decision=pass reason=output above protective minimum; no mismatches
02:26:52 way_gate decision=pass reason=no declared way_path (Way check NA); no coercion language
02:26:52 execution_gate decision=deferred reason=no witnesses available (Witness Roll not yet constituted)
02:26:52 signed hash_algo=sha256 hash=sha256:53c273b660faf1384cfe8abeb8b1001bd676849f42a87be7e9a150fec22f7f82

Content hash

sha256:53c273b660faf1384cfe8abeb8b1001bd676849f42a87be7e9a150fec22f7f82

SHA256 over the canonical JSON (excluding this field). Tamper detection. Ed25519 signing planned for v2 once the operator’s signing key is provisioned on disk.

Bring another teaching · Run a discernment